Brazil Potash Corp. Common Shares (GRO) is trading at $2.93 as of 2026-04-20, posting a 4.56% decline in recent trading. This analysis outlines key technical levels for GRO, prevailing market context for the agricultural inputs sector, and potential near-term price scenarios for investors to monitor.
